By importing a document (a HTML file named as .XLS or .HTML) with lots (more than 15000) of rows, OpenOffice Calc truncates data without showing any error or warning.

The issue can be reproduced by importing attached file into calc. On my machine it imports just 13635 of the 20000 rows.

I was able to reproduce this issue. I tried importing the attached file in calc and found the same issue, only 13635 rows of the 20000 were imported. 

Out of curiosity, I also tried this by creating a .htm file in excel with one column of 20000 rows. This opened in OpenOffice Calc and showed all 20000 rows.

Could this be a problem due to the amount of data?
